Skip to content
Advanced TEMPEST technology for a safer future
Search for:
Home
Products
About OSPL
Facilities
Careers
Services
Certifications
News
Contact us
3.7 x 23 x 13cm. Weight: 2.5kg
Home
»
3.7 x 23 x 13cm. Weight: 2.5kg
No products were found matching your selection.
Page load link
Go to Top